Angel Di María has blamed his unhappy spell at #mufc on Louis van Gaal and life in Manchester. “I started really well. Everything was perfect. But then suddenly we started having lots of meetings about all the things I was doing wrong on the pitch. He never showed me what I was doing well, just the negatives, over and over. Eventually I got fed up. Life there [in Manchester] was very different. It gets dark really early and then the cold started. Everything kept snowballing. There was also the break-in at my house. I got robbed in Paris too and still stayed for another two or three years, because life there was good. In Manchester, everything just snowballed. I wanted to prioritise my family and that is why I left.” [BBC]

Two rides at Thorpe Park, including the brand new Hyperia, broke down at the same time yesterday on the hottest Bank Holiday Monday on record. Riders were left stranded 200 feet up at the apex of Hyperia for around 30 minutes in 33°C heat, before the ride was eventually restarted. A second ride at the park also went down simultaneously, leaving visitors stuck mid-ride during the peak of the heatwave.
